Last April 22nd we kicked-off our very first LIGHTHOUSE SESSION – a talk on welcoming Ukrainian refugees in creative hubs and cultural structures.
At ECHN we invited creative professionals to share their experience in dealing with the migrant crisis – this motivated a great discussion and sharing of case studies, best practices and tools for effective support. The aim is to create a learning opportunity and debate for the hubs dealing with welcoming people in vulnerable situations for the first time and with no past experience.
This event was open to all hub managers, creative and coworking spaces, Cultural Organisations and all the structures that want to contribute to the situation and have the space and capacity to.
